“Mandalorian” actress and World Wrestling Entertainment (WWE) star Sasha Banks is taking heat for allegedly “liking” an Instagram post that questions the safety of the COVID-19 vaccine.

The screen-capped posts that made Banks trend online and sparked criticism of the actress being a so-called “anti-vaxxer” are not entirely clear.

Twitter user @tayredacted posted two photos of images Banks supposedly “liked” from Instagram that were posted in May. One image suggests the COVID-19 vaccine is meant to sterilize the masses, and the other reads, “COVID Jab: They skipped all animal trails because all animals were dying & went directly to people.”

There is no evidence the vaccines cause infertility, and according to Reuters, the claims made in the Texas Senate about skipping animal trials because of dying animals are false.

The images come from the same post, however, and they come after you scroll past numerous other photos in the post. In other words, Banks could have “liked” the first photo, which is a mild meme mocking lockdown measures, and not even seen the other posts about the vaccine. See the front image, below:

Notably, Lucasfilm fired “Mandalorian” actress Gina Carano earlier this year after she publicly voiced conservative views on social media.

In the aftermath, Carano partnered with The Daily Wire to produce and star in an upcoming film.
